关注
回答下第二个问题。
一般来说,就是如果你的系统不是严格要求缓存+数据库必须一致性的话,缓存可以稍微的跟数据库偶尔有不一致的情况,最好不要做这个方案,读请求和写请求串行化,串到一个内存队列里去,这样就可以保证一定不会出现不一致的情况。串行化之后,就会导致系统的吞吐量会大幅度的降低,用比正常情况下多几倍的机器去支撑线上的一个请求。
还有一种方式就是可能会暂时产生不一致的情况,但是发生的几率特别小,就是先更新数据库,然后再删除缓存。
查看原帖
2 1
相关推荐
查看6道真题和解析 点赞 评论 收藏
分享
查看6道真题和解析 点赞 评论 收藏
分享
点赞 评论 收藏
分享
牛客热帖
更多
正在热议
更多
# 长得好看会提高面试通过率吗? #
9151次浏览 89人参与
# 面试被问第一学历差时该怎么回答 #
274075次浏览 2224人参与
# 巨人网络春招 #
11842次浏览 235人参与
# 沪漂/北漂你觉得哪个更苦? #
3340次浏览 67人参与
# 百度工作体验 #
316818次浏览 2234人参与
# 你的实习产出是真实的还是包装的? #
5829次浏览 97人参与
# 米连集团26产品管培生项目 #
8961次浏览 246人参与
# 离家近房租贵VS离家远但房租低,怎么选 #
17190次浏览 139人参与
# 学历or实习经历,哪个更重要 #
242953次浏览 1259人参与
# AI面会问哪些问题? #
2094次浏览 59人参与
# 从事AI岗需要掌握哪些技术栈? #
1339次浏览 41人参与
# 你做过最难的笔试是哪家公司 #
2830次浏览 33人参与
# HR最不可信的一句话是__ #
1709次浏览 44人参与
# 春招至今,你的战绩如何? #
21611次浏览 203人参与
# 找AI工作可以去哪些公司? #
1248次浏览 21人参与
# 校招生月薪1W算什么水平 #
134718次浏览 456人参与
# AI时代,哪个岗位还有“活路” #
4259次浏览 100人参与
# XX请雇我工作 #
51275次浏览 172人参与
# 简历第一个项目做什么 #
33117次浏览 429人参与
# 你最满意的offer薪资是哪家公司? #
77250次浏览 378人参与
# 不考虑薪资和职业,你最想做什么工作呢? #
153342次浏览 894人参与
# 秋招白月光 #
734676次浏览 5456人参与
